Directions

  1. * Personal note:
  2. I suggest that you soak your duck breast in very cold light brine for 24-48 hours to get the gamey flavor out of it. Change the brine after each day.
  3. Brine Recipe:
  4. 4 cups water.
  5. 1/4 cup salt.
  6. 1/4 cup Brown Sugar.
  7. Heat water to boiling, dissolve salt and sugar into water. Let brine cool completely before submerging duck breasts in chunks. I recommend placing it into the refrigerator to get it cold.
  8. Patties:
  9. In a bowl, add the meat, herbs and salt and pepper. Mix all together well done making 8-oz. each patty.
  10. Grill your Turducken patties to minimum 165 degrees and melt your Irish Porter Cheese on them. The bacon grease adds fat, we want to aim for a 80/20 mix of meat to fat, much like ground beef.
